<blockquote>Navigating the NURS FPX 4015 Course: A Step-by-Step Guide to Assessments 1–4</blockquote> <blockquote>Capella University’s <strong>NURS FPX 4015</strong> course, <em>Health Promotion and Disease Prevention in Vulnerable and Diverse Populations</em>, is designed to help nursing students deepen their understanding of patient-centered care. Focused on outreach, education, and prevention strategies, this course equips learners with practical tools for working with individuals across diverse and often underserved populations.</blockquote> <blockquote>From interviewing a volunteer patient to creating concept maps and health education presentations, this course includes four important assessments that gradually build your confidence and clinical judgment. In this blog post, we’ll explore each stage—<strong>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 1 to 4</strong>—with embedded resources to guide you through every step.</blockquote> <blockquote>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 1: Interviewing a Volunteer Patient</blockquote> <blockquote>The course kicks off with a meaningful hands-on experience in <a href="https://www.writinkservices.com/nurs-fpx-4015-assessment-1-volunteer-patient/"><strong>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 1</strong></a>, where students are required to interview a volunteer patient. This interview focuses on health concerns, lifestyle factors, and community-related risks that may affect the individual’s well-being.</blockquote> <blockquote>In this assessment, you will:</blockquote> <ul> <li> <blockquote>Identify social determinants of health (SDOH)</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Discuss preventive health practices</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Evaluate the patient’s access to care and available resources</blockquote> </li> </ul> <blockquote>This task not only enhances your communication skills but also provides a firsthand look at how real-world barriers impact patient health. Your written report should include detailed observations, health goals, and initial nursing recommendations supported by evidence-based practice.</blockquote> <blockquote>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 2: Determining Root-Cause Issues</blockquote> <blockquote>Building upon the interview from Assessment 1, <a href="https://www.writinkservices.com/nurs-fpx-4015-assessment-2/"><strong>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 2</strong></a> asks students to dive deeper into identifying the <strong>root causes</strong> of the patient's health challenges. This is a critical-thinking exercise where you’ll look at more than just symptoms—you’ll analyze the broader picture, including emotional, economic, and environmental influences.</blockquote> <blockquote>To excel in this assessment:</blockquote> <ul> <li> <blockquote>Conduct a needs-based assessment using community and patient data</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Utilize risk scoring tools</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Identify interventions that promote health and prevent disease</blockquote> </li> </ul> <blockquote>The goal is to uncover why certain health risks persist and to propose practical, culturally sensitive nursing strategies to mitigate them. This assessment aligns well with real-life nursing roles, especially in community health and primary care.</blockquote> <blockquote>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 3: Creating a Concept Map</blockquote> <blockquote>Next, <a href="https://www.writinkservices.com/nurs-fpx-4015-assessment-3-concept-map-the-3-ps/"><strong>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 3</strong></a> focuses on the “3 P’s”: <strong>Pathophysiology, Pharmacology, and Physical Assessment</strong>. This assignment involves creating a visual concept map that illustrates the relationships among these three key components of a specific condition your patient is facing.</blockquote> <blockquote>Here’s what to include in your concept map:</blockquote> <ul> <li> <blockquote>A central health condition (e.g., hypertension, diabetes)</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Linked symptoms, medications, and pathophysiological mechanisms</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Related physical findings from your patient interaction</blockquote> </li> </ul> <blockquote>Concept maps are excellent tools for visual learners and help clarify complex clinical information. Your map should also demonstrate your ability to synthesize scientific knowledge with practical nursing care. Be sure to cite clinical guidelines and peer-reviewed sources to support your choices.</blockquote> <blockquote>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 4: Delivering a Teaching Presentation</blockquote> <blockquote>The final step of this course culminates in <a href="https://www.writinkservices.com/nurs-fpx-4015-assessment-4-caring-for-special-populations-teaching-presentation/"><strong>NURS FPX 4015 Assessment 4</strong></a>, where you’ll deliver a <strong>teaching presentation tailored to a vulnerable or special population</strong>. This could include immigrants, elderly individuals, low-income groups, or those with chronic conditions.</blockquote> <blockquote>This presentation should:</blockquote> <ul> <li> <blockquote>Educate the target audience on health promotion topics</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Use plain language and culturally appropriate examples</blockquote> </li> <li> <blockquote>Include visuals, handouts, or digital tools for clarity</blockquote> </li> </ul> <blockquote>Whether you’re creating a PowerPoint or conducting a recorded talk, your delivery must be informative, respectful, and engaging. The purpose is to empower patients through knowledge—an essential component of population-based care.</blockquote> <blockquote>Why These Assessments Matter</blockquote> <blockquote>The <strong>NURS FPX 4015</strong> course assessments serve more than just academic goals.
